PHP Basics

Error and Exception Handlers


Throws internal errors as exceptions.

If registered as error handler, this converts an internal PHP error into an ErrorException. It respects the error_reporting directive.

> Usage: set_error_handler(new ThrowErrorException());


Triggers errors for uncaught exceptions.

If registered as exception handler, this catches an uncaught exception and converts it into an internal PHP error of severity E_USER_ERROR.

> Usage: set_exception_handler(new TriggerExceptionError());

Search results